Category: Filters Group: important Status: Open Resolution: None Priority: 5 Private: No Submitted By: Nobody/Anonymous (nobody) Assigned to: Nobody/Anonymous (nobody) Summary: X-Over crashes on input of zero Initial Comment: According to the LADSPA specificaton, a plugin may have a preferred range but must function at any range. The GLAME X-Over filter crashes the host when the cutoff frequency is given an input of 0.
